Here’s a quick, high-protein recipe for Greek Yogurt with Honey and Granola
a perfect snack or light meal for bodybuilders or anyone needing a balanced, muscle-friendly option packed with protein, healthy carbs, and fats!
Ingredients
- 1 cup plain Greek yogurt (non-fat or low-fat)
- 1-2 tbsp honey (or maple syrup for a vegan option)
- 1/4 cup granola (choose low-sugar or homemade for better macros)
- Optional toppings: fresh berries, sliced banana, chia seeds, or nuts
Instructions
1. Layer the Yogurt:
- Scoop Greek yogurt into a bowl.
2. Add Sweetener:
- Drizzle honey or maple syrup over the yogurt.
3. Top with Granola:
- Sprinkle granola evenly over the yogurt.
4. Optional Toppings:
- Add fresh berries, banana slices, chia seeds, or nuts for extra flavor and nutrients.
5. Serve:
- Enjoy immediately as a quick snack or light meal!
Macros (Approximate)
- Calories: ~250-300 kcal
- Protein: ~20-25g (from Greek yogurt)
- Carbs: ~30-35g (from granola and honey)
- Fats: ~5-8g (from granola and optional nuts)

Pro Tips
- Meal Prep: Pre-portion yogurt and toppings in jars for grab-and-go snacks.
- Boost Protein: Add a scoop of protein powder or collagen to the yogurt.
- Lower Sugar: Use unsweetened granola and reduce honey to 1 tsp.
- Extra Crunch: Add flaxseeds, pumpkin seeds, or toasted coconut.
